Abstract: A display device includes: a substrate including a display area, and a peripheral area around the display area; a pad portion at the peripheral area, and including a first pad and a second pad adjacent to each other; a fan-out wire portion including a first fan-out wire below the first pad and connected to the first pad through a first contact hole to extend to the display area, and a second fan-out wire below the second pad and connected to the second pad through a second contact hole to extend to the display area; and a conductive layer between an upper portion of the fan-out wire portion and a lower portion of the pad portion, and at least partially corresponding to an overlapping area of the fan-out wire portion and the pad portion. The second fan-out wire at least partially overlaps with the first pad.

Abstract: An organic light-emitting display apparatus is provided as follows. A thin film transistor is disposed on a substrate. A first insulating layer covers the thin film transistor. The first insulating layer includes a barrier wall and a flat portion. The barrier wall protrudes from the flat portion. A pixel electrode is disposed on the flat portion surrounded by the barrier wall. The pixel electrode is electrically connected to the thin film transistor. A pixel defining layer is disposed on the pixel electrode and partially exposes the pixel electrode.

Abstract: A display apparatus includes a substrate, a first data line in a display area, a first input line in a peripheral area, and a first connecting wire electrically connected to the first input line in a peripheral area of the substrate. The first connecting wire transfers a first input signal from the first input line to the first data line. The first connecting wire includes a first connecting line disposed in a display area of the substrate and extending in the first direction, and a second connecting line electrically connected to the first connecting line and extending in a second direction intersecting the first direction. The first connecting line and the second connecting line are disposed on different layers.

Abstract: A display apparatus includes a substrate including a display area including a main display area and an edge display area extended directly from a side of the main display area, and a peripheral area outside the display area and including a pad area through which electrical signals are applied to the display area; and in the peripheral area, a plurality of wirings between the display area and the pad area and through which the electrical signals are transmitted from the pad area to the display area, the plurality of wirings including: a first wiring through which an electrical signal is transmitted from the pad area to the main display area, and a second wiring through which an electrical signal is transmitted from the pad area to the edge display area, where an electrical resistance per unit length of the first wiring is greater than that of the second wiring.

Abstract: A display device may include a substrate, a pixel, a transistor, a data line, a connection line, a pad, and an electrostatic discharge protection circuit. The substrate may include a display area and a pad area. The pad area may overlap the display area. The pixel may be supported by the display area and may include a pixel electrode. The data line may be electrically connected through the transistor to the pixel electrode. The connection line may be supported by the display area and may be electrically connected through the data line to the transistor. The pad may be supported by the pad area and may be electrically connected through the connection line to the data line. The display area and the pad area may be positioned between the connection line and the pad. The electrostatic discharge protection circuit may be electrically connected to the connection line.
